About Hooker, OK
Hooker is a small community in Oklahoma with a population of 1,553 residents. The median household income is $47,461 per year, which is below the national average. The median age in Hooker is 34.9 years.
Housing in Hooker has a median home value of $143,500 and median monthly rent of $944. Of the 744 total housing units, the majority are owner-occupied, with 427 owner-occupied and 190 renter-occupied units.
The unemployment rate in Hooker is 4.7% and the poverty rate is 13.2%. 33.8%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The average commute time is 23.4 minutes.
Cost of Living in Hooker, OK
Compared to national averages, Hooker has a median household income of $47,461 (37% below the national median of $75,149). Home values average $143,500, which is 41% below the national median. Monthly rent at $944 is 19% below the US average of $1,163. Within Oklahoma, Hooker's income is 16% below the state average of $56,382, and home values are 20% above the state median of $119,992.
